Chapter 1
Tapping on her steering wheel, lost in thought, Emma exhales deeply as she tilts her head and peers out of her windscreen, towards the nearby bar situated in a back street of Seattle. Switching off the engine, the conflicted blonde sits back against her seat and bites her lip nervously. Should she just go in? The dreadful feeling in the pit of her stomach was telling her otherwise. Ever since leaving Storybrooke, she couldn't help but wonder what she would find or who. Surely if her wife had been herself, she would have made it her priority to make her way back home instead of setting up a bar which to Emma, had merely been two months ago. Two months since the curse hit and she found herself separated from those she loved most. They had been on a spontaneous adventure/honeymoon to the enchanted forest as a promise to Henry, their son, who had never been and now that the bean crop had manifested they could. That was when it all went wrong. Just like the original curse that the evil queen had enacted, only a portion of the kingdom was hit and unfortunately the two women were travelling apart. As soon as she made it back to her parents in Storybrooke with Henry in tow, Emma was determined to figure out what the hell had happened and where her wife was.
Now she was here, having found the location from the help of Belle who was also concerned over Rumple's whereabouts as he too had disappeared. It had also taken a lot of encouragement for Henry to stay at home in case it's a lost cause and to prevent the boy any heartache other his missing mother. Counting down in her mind, Emma hastily pushes her door open and steps out, closing it behind her and locking it quickly to prevent her changing her mind. Pulling on the hem of her leather jacket, she straightens and makes her way up to the bar. Continuing with her stride, the blonde yanks on the door and walks inside, making a beeline for the bar. Taking in her surroundings, Emma raises an eyebrow on its interior as it certainly was not up to Regina's standards but more laid back and had a rock vibe to the place. Noticing a bartender approach, she has no choice but to order a drink without looking weird and so orders a beer and continues to stare around the establishment for the woman who is desperately on her mind.
"Now you look like you could do with something stronger than a beer.."
Whipping her head back towards the bar at the familiar voice, Emma's mouth drops open, speechless at the woman in front of her.
Letting out a throaty chuckle, the woman drapes an arm over one of the beer pumps and leans forward with a whisper. "Don't worry, I won't tell anyone. So what will you have? Whiskey? Scotch?"
Clearing her throat awkwardly, the blonde blinks and finds her voice. "I..erm...yeah a whiskey would be...great"
Giving a small nod, the bartender turns to grab a glass and presses it against the optics to pour a measure. Sliding it across the counter top, she slowly smiles. "..on the house.."
Gripping the glass tightly, Emma also attempts a smile. "Thanks..."
"Names' Roni.."
Inhaling sharply, the blonde continues to stare until she realises that Roni is beginning to frown. "Oh..I'm..Emma.."
Pursuing her lip at the newcomers name, the bartender reaches for a shot glass filled with tequila and knocks it back. "Emma. It's nice to meet ya. What brings you to this neck of the woods?"
Sipping at her glass, Emma tries to avoid the curly haired brunette's gaze and mutters. "Business.."
Witnessing the blonde tense up and turn away, clearly not interested in sharing any information with her, Roni nods and begins to move away to carry on her job. "Got it.."
Lifting her head to watch as the bartender rounds the bar and grabs a few glasses, the saddened woman bites her lip. "I didn't mean for that to sound so blunt. It's complicated..and at the moment I'm missing my family being here.."
Pausing in her step, Roni tilts her head with a small smile. "That must be nice..to have a family to go home to" frowning once again, she sighs. "or even anyone for that matter.."
"Yeah it is. Especially when there is a child involved.."
Strolling back to the bar and stopping beside the blondes stool, the brunette places her glasses down and leans against the surface with one knee bent as her boot pressed against the wooden panel. "You have a kid?"
"A son. Henry. He's just turned fifteen"
Raising an eyebrow at the admission, Roni looks surprised. "Wow..you certainly don't look old enough.."
Sniggering with a shrug, Emma downs the rest of her drink. "I can be when..I've had a teen pregnancy.."
"Oh.." realising that this woman seems to have a lot of baggage and she has her rep to uphold, the brunette goes behind the bar and shifts the glasses to wash.
Tapping on her empty glass, the blonde watches every movement and detail from her oblivious wife. From her cropped black laced jacket, covering a tank top and her small spiked ankle boots at the bottom of her jean covered legs. This was definitely not the wardrobe of Regina Mills.
"Roni! A beer when you're ready love.."
Glancing across to the newcomer perched on the next stool, Emma tries to hide her shock in which she sees Killian, better known as Captain Hook, sat beside her.
Peering over her shoulder, Roni smiles and chucks the dishcloth at him playfully. "Can't you see I'm busy detective? You'll have to wait.."
Laughing, the tall bearded man throws the cloth back and waits. "Typical.."
Chuckling back at his remark, the bartender gestures with her head towards Emma. "Why don't you keep blondie here company..Rogers, Emma, Emma, Rogers.."
Smirking over at the blonde, the detective holds his hand out. "It's about time this dive got some new friendly faces.."
Accepting with a gulp, Emma gives a brief smile before standing from her stool. "Actually I better get going.." turning her gaze back to Roni, she nods. "It was..nice..meeting you and thanks for the drink.."
"Doors always open"
"Right.." moving herself away from the bar, Emma slowly makes her way towards the exit while hearing an eruption of laughter coming from the brunette at something Rogers said.
It used to be only Emma to receive that type of sound from her wife's lips.

"I panicked!"
"Oh Emma, honey I know this must be excruciating for you but at least now you've found her and we will work something out. Belle is still working on a spell to figure out this new curse. For now, what would you like me to tell Henry?"
Flopping back onto her mattress, Emma stares up at her hotel room ceiling. "I don't know. I want him to know I found her but..she's not her. I don't want Henry going through anymore heartache. Maybe just tell him I have a lead?"
"Okay, I will tell him at dinner. I hope that you're looking after yourself. I wish I could be there with you"
"I know and thanks but..this, I need to do on my own." Chuckling in disbelief, the blonde begins to twirl her wedding ring which was currently adorned on a necklace. "I honestly thought it would be okay..that I'd find her and that would be it. She doesn't have a clue. I just don't know what to do"
"You'll figure it out honey. You always do."
Raising a hand in the air in annoyance, Emma blurts out. "She was flirting with Killian!"
"Hook was there?"
"Yes he was and also completely clueless"
"Too be honest Emma that sounds about right for him anyway"
Sniggering at her mothers attempt of cheering her up, Emma sighs as silence takes over the conversation. "I just want to bring her home. You should have seen her mom, spiked boots and curly hair. She was so..carefree..but the attitude was there, not to mention asking me if I had a kid. A kid?! That's normally what I'd say!"
"Did she seem happy?"
Running a hand through her hair, the blonde pouts. "She was..but there was something..that wasn't right. Like she's suppressing.."
"Putting on a front you mean?"
"Yeah..anyway I'm going to go back tomorrow. Hopefully I'll have a plan by then..I'll call you tomorrow night and make sure Henry gets his school work done otherwise Regina would kill me"
"Will do. We love you Emma."
"Love you too mom.."

There was no plan.
Which was why, once again, Emma sat within her bug and stared at the large neon sign that hung against the main doors. The word 'Roni' clearly taunting her. Letting out a growl of frustration, she climbs out of her car and walks straight through into the bar.
Peering briefly for the pump while serving a customer, Roni raises an eyebrow as she was not expecting to see her again anytime soon. Placing the beer down and accepting the money, she goes to the register to deposit then makes her way over towards the blonde while placing her hands into her back pockets. "Didn't think I'd see you again. Aside from the odd person we rarely keep the same customers.."
Shrugging, Emma slides up onto the stool. "Yeah well I'm here for a little while so.."
"So...you thought you'd turn into an alcoholic?"
Frowning towards the brunette, the blonde then smiles seeing the woman smirk teasingly. "Well I'd be doing you a favour.."
Laughing at the comment, the bartender nods in agreement then leans against the counter top. "So what will you be having?"
Biting her lip, Emma grows sad at a thought but masks her features. "Got any apple cider?"
Appearing impressed, Roni turns to retrieve a bottle. "Yes I do. It'll be the best you ever tasted" leaning down to take a glass, she places both in front of the blonde with a smile.
Pouring the contents of the bottle, the blonde chuckles at the whole situation. "Oh I don't doubt that.."x
